Program Structure and Specializations
Psychology programs in Turkey typically follow a structured curriculum comprising core courses in foundational psychological theories and research methodologies. Most universities offer various specializations at both the undergraduate and postgraduate levels. Undergraduate Programs in Turkey:
Undergraduate psychology programs generally span four years, leading to a Bachelor’s degree in Psychology. Many universities offer double major options in Turkey, allowing for further specialization.
Postgraduate Programs in Turkey:
Master’s degree programs (Master’s degree in Turkey) and PhD programs (PhD programs in Turkey) offer advanced specialization in areas such as clinical psychology, developmental psychology, social psychology, neuropsychology, and industrial-organizational psychology. Career Opportunities After Graduation
A psychology degree from a Turkish university opens doors to a variety of career paths. Graduates can pursue careers in clinical settings, research institutions, educational environments, or corporate settings. The Career services at Turkish universities often provide valuable support in finding employment opportunities.
Clinical Psychology:
Graduates can work as therapists, counselors, or psychologists in hospitals, clinics, or private practices. Further specialization is often necessary.
Research:
Many graduates find employment in research institutions, conducting studies, and contributing to the advancement of the field. Look into Research grants for international students in Turkey to fund research opportunities.
Education:
Psychology graduates can work as teachers, lecturers, or researchers in universities, colleges, or schools.
Industry:
Many organizations employ psychologists to focus on human resources, organizational development, market research, and user experience design.
